The Bible in Basic English
Psalms, Chapter 95

   1: O come, let us make songs to the Lord; sending up glad voices to the Rock of our salvation.
   2: Let us come before his face with praises; and make melody with holy songs.
   3: For the Lord is a great God, and a great King over all gods.
   4: The deep places of the earth are in his hand; and the tops of the mountains are his.
   5: The sea is his, and he made it; and the dry land was formed by his hands.
   6: O come, let us give worship, falling down on our knees before the Lord our Maker.
   7: For he is our God; and we are the people to whom he gives food, and the sheep of his flock. Today, if you would only give ear to his voice!
   8: Let not your hearts be hard, as at Meribah, as in the day of Massah in the waste land;
   9: When your fathers put me to the test and saw my power and my work.
   10: For forty years I was angry with this generation, and said, They are a people whose hearts are turned away from me, for they have no knowledge of my ways;
   11: And I made an oath in my wrath, that they might not come into my place of rest.
